Update for parties who may be interested.

 

Further to my request for information on this matter:

 

Took taxi from outside Majestic Suites at 6:30 pm on Wednesday last.

Went via the toll road.

Arrived at the Airport at 7 pm.

Fare as on the meter 187 Baht

Tolls extra 40 + 25 Baht.

Alleged surcharge for taxi to airport 50 baht.

Total 302 plus tip.

 

Note Driver said it would cost 450 Baht plus tolls. He emphasised it by saying that the airport was outside Bangkok you know. This statement just made me smile to myself and was very tempted to ask him was Don Mueng not also outside Bangkok. I told the driver it may be more like 300 Baht on which we agreed. Of course the Driver was laughing when the meter only showed 187. However, an agreement was made so 300 was paid. I'm saying this to alert others to be cautious on what agreement you make with the Driver. I should add I was happy and so was he. No tip needed since he got 65 Baht anyway over the odds.

The only airport surcharge is when a taxi picks-up at the airport, not dropping off.

 

There are Airport Bus signs at some of the Sukhumvit bus stops but as stated before, the wait can be unpredictable, sometimes long; then three buses will come along in two minutes.

 

Once you are on the bus, it is actually pretty quick, it jumps onto the x-way and gets to Suvarnabhumi in about 25 minutes. The last time I took it the fare was still B100 but that may have changed.

I do like to take that bus when I leave the airport: schedules are predictable and it drops me off a block from my soi.
